Mouse: P.I. For Hire Reveals Robo-Betty Boss Fight Gameplay

Fumi Games and PlaySide Studios have released a brand-new gameplay trailer for Mouse: P.I. For Hire, showcasing an explosive new boss encounter.

The footage premiered at the Convergence Showcase and introduces Robo-Betty, a previously unseen boss who lurks deep within a secret laboratory in the crime-ridden city of Mouseburg.

Meet Robo-Betty

Robo-Betty resides in the depths of a hidden lab and serves as one of the game’s standout boss encounters. Players will face her in an intense three-stage battle, escalating in spectacle and danger as the fight progresses.

The trailer teases dynamic attack patterns, environmental hazards, and the manic, over-the-top energy that defines the game’s chaotic combat.

Rubber Hose Noir Mayhem

Mouse: P.I. For Hire draws heavily on 1930s animation and classic noir cinema. Its black-and-white, rubber hose art style is hand-drawn frame by frame, delivering a distinctive vintage cartoon aesthetic rarely seen in modern first-person shooters.

Underneath the stylized visuals lies fast-paced, boomer shooter-inspired action. Players can expect explosive FPS combat featuring a wild arsenal of creatively twisted firearms, experimental weapons, and relentless enemy encounters.

From lethal mobsters to towering boss battles like Robo-Betty, the citizens of Mouseburg won’t go down without a fight.
